Understanding Hypervisors: The Backbone of Cloud Computing

A hypervisor is crucial for cloud environments, allowing multiple operating systems to function on a single machine, maximizing efficiency and scalability. Dive into its role, types, and importance in virtual environments.

What’s a Hypervisor, Anyway?

You’ve probably heard the term ‘hypervisor’ thrown around in conversations about cloud computing and virtualization. But what does it actually mean? Well, let’s break it down in a way that makes sense, even if you’re new to this whole tech thing.

Cutting through the Jargon

Think of a hypervisor as the efficient manager of a busy office that houses multiple businesses. Each business (or operating system) can thrive independently, but they share the same office space (the physical server). Just as a good office manager ensures that each company has the resources they need without stepping on each other’s toes, a hypervisor runs multiple operating systems on one machine, ensuring they operate smoothly without interference.

What Does a Hypervisor Do?

At its core, a hypervisor allows different operating systems to coexist on a single physical hardware platform. This is a game-changer for cloud service providers. They can host diverse applications, each running their unique OS, all while keeping them isolated. This isolation is crucial because it enhances security and stability. Imagine how disastrous it would be if one application's error brought down the entire server—yikes!

Types of Hypervisors

Curious about the kinds of hypervisors out there? There are primarily two types:

  • Type 1 Hypervisor:
    Also known as bare-metal hypervisors, these run directly on the hardware. This type provides better performance and scalability. Think of it as the building manager who directly oversees the office without needing someone else’s permission.

  • Type 2 Hypervisor:
    These run atop an existing operating system, like Windows or Linux. They’re generally easier to set up and manage for individual users or small businesses. It’s like a temporary office space that can be set up quickly but may lack some of the efficiencies of a traditional office layout.

Why is this Important?

You know what really seals the deal on the usefulness of hypervisors? They enable better resource utilization. By having multiple virtual machines share the same physical hardware, cloud environments can maximize their computing power. It’s like getting a two-for-one deal at your favorite restaurant—who wouldn’t love that?

Wrapping Your Head Around Virtualization

When discussing hypervisors, you’ll often hear the term ‘virtualization’ as well. What’s the relationship? Virtualization is the overarching concept that allows you to create virtual versions of physical resources, while a hypervisor is the tool that makes this magic happen.

In Conclusion

To sum it all up, a hypervisor is not just another tech buzzword; it’s an essential part of modern cloud computing. By enabling multiple operating systems to run on one machine, hypervisors enhance efficiency, scalability, and resource management in the cloud. Next time you think about a cloud environment, remember the role of hypervisors—those unsung heroes behind the curtain that keep everything running smoothly.

So, whether you're studying for your Certificate of Cloud Security Knowledge or just curious about cloud infrastructure, understanding hypervisors gives you a great foundation in grasping how powerful and flexible cloud computing can be!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y